-
- Downloads
Merge branch...
Merge branch '21636-deleting-source-project-with-existing-fork-closes-all-related-merge-requests' into 'master' Deleting source project with existing fork link should closes all related merge requests, and does not render `invalid` template for merge requests with deleted source project. The merge request without source project can be edited but can't be reopened. Closes #21636 See merge request !6177
Showing
- CHANGELOG 1 addition, 0 deletionsCHANGELOG
- app/controllers/projects/merge_requests_controller.rb 0 additions, 6 deletionsapp/controllers/projects/merge_requests_controller.rb
- app/models/merge_request.rb 10 additions, 0 deletionsapp/models/merge_request.rb
- app/services/projects/destroy_service.rb 2 additions, 0 deletionsapp/services/projects/destroy_service.rb
- app/views/projects/merge_requests/_discussion.html.haml 1 addition, 1 deletionapp/views/projects/merge_requests/_discussion.html.haml
- app/views/projects/merge_requests/_show.html.haml 17 additions, 14 deletionsapp/views/projects/merge_requests/_show.html.haml
- spec/controllers/projects_controller_spec.rb 19 additions, 0 deletionsspec/controllers/projects_controller_spec.rb
- spec/models/merge_request_spec.rb 77 additions, 0 deletionsspec/models/merge_request_spec.rb
Loading
Please register or sign in to comment